how the 2.5bar pressure able to control the 40bar steam

Answer Posted / mohamed yousuf(instrumentation

according to the formula P=F/A

Actually we are applying the 2.5 bar pressure to the
diaphram actuator. By increasing the area of diaphram we
can increse the force acting on the diaphram and that muuch
of force is more enough to actuate the stem movement.even
though 40 bar pressure is applied only to the small area
(plug of the control valve).the force actiong on it will be
very small.
